You cant really ensure an even spread... it makes no difference if you have all the best players, or if the best players are spread across all teams. its more the second and third teir players that you HAVE to pick. Someone will have cox/judd/ablett etc in every league... it will come down to the lower ranked players people pick

Your logic makes NO sense what so ever....

Based on your logic, of league strength NOT individual strength..

Think about this

Person A has - Cox, White, Bartel, Ablett
(He gets all the best players)
Person Z has - Simmonds, Kreuzer, Palmer, Ebert
(He gets all the leftover players)

HOW is this different to this scenario, scoring wise?

Person A has - Cox, Kruezer, Palmer, Ablett
Person Z has - White, Simmonds, Ebert, Bartel...

Yes, you guessed it, there is NO difference in the scoring of the LEAGUE!

My view is it best to be number 1-5.
Most of the really elite players are in that bracket.
Its far better to have 1,20,21,40 - then 10,11,30,31.
The quality of players after the top 30 goes down significantly and most players are about the same after that.
